揭秘如何利用分布式Redis完成数据同步(分布式redis如何同步)
随着企业的规模和需求日益增长,服务器的集群结构和分布式存储已经成为集中管理数据的重要方式,支持各个系统的正常运行,利用这种集群的技术能够可靠的提高系统的可用性、扩展性和灵活性。
其中,Redis分布式存储是当下应用最广泛的一种分布式数据库存储技术,它支持跨平台数据库部署、支持高可用性,方便应用解决分布式集群部署带来的数据同步问题。本文将揭秘如何利用Redis完成数据的同步。
需要说明的是,Redis的分布式存储以一个单实例的Redis服务器为基础,支持在一组Redis server部署,每台服务器都由多个节点组成,作为数据库同步时站点之间数据共享的终端。
在实际部署中,为每台Redis服务器安装相应的驱动程序,在这些节点上配置服务器名称、服务器IP等,节点之间建立好连接即可实现集群功能。
利用Redis的数据同步需要使用redis-cli命令工具,将数据从原始服务器同步到目的服务器,从而实现数据同步,如下代码实现:
#从原始服务器拉取数据
redis-cli –slave host:port –auth password
#复制数据到目的服务器
redis-cli –master host: port –auth password
Redis还支持自动数据同步功能,可以将连接的Redis服务器同步到一致的数据集中,以此来实现数据的高可用性。此外,Redis还支持自动数据备份功能,这种功能可以确保在物理硬件损坏时,数据安全性得到很好的保护。
通过本文介绍,读者应该能够清楚的了解如何利用Redis进行分布式数据库同步,能够实现数据的可靠性、快速性和方便性,在实现数据集中管理方面尤其有用。希望大家可以结合自己的场景,努力实现更高效的数据管理系统。
相关文章